Selecting and Preparing Acacia Wood

The process begins with careful selection of raw acacia lumber. Acacia trees produce dense, sturdy hardwood with naturally rich color variation, which makes each board unique. The wood must undergo controlled drying to reduce moisture content to an optimal level. Proper drying prevents warping, cracking, and uneven texture during later stages of production.

Acacia boards are typically kiln-dried until they reach a stable moisture percentage that supports precise shaping. Cutting and Shaping the Wood

Once acacia wood is prepared, it is cut into planks that will form the body of the cutting board. The dimensions depend on the final design—whether the board will be rectangular, round, thick, or styled for serving. Cutting must be precise to ensure uniform thickness and seamless assembly later.

The shaping process involves trimming edges, smoothing surfaces, and preparing the planks for jointing. Acacia wood’s density provides excellent structural integrity, allowing boards to maintain a stable cutting surface even under frequent knife contact. Joining the Wood Planks

Many high-quality cutting boards are constructed by assembling several planks side by side. This increases structural strength and reduces the risk of deformation. For acacia boards, planks with complementary grain patterns are carefully selected to ensure visual harmony.

An industrial-grade adhesive safe for food contact is applied to the edges before the planks are aligned and clamped. The clamping step must hold the wood firmly until the adhesive cures completely. This process results in a solid, stable base from which the board takes its final form.

Sanding and Surface Refinement

After the board is formed, sanding becomes one of the most important steps. Proper sanding smooths the surface, rounds the edges, and enhances the tactile feel. Multiple rounds of sanding—progressing from coarse to fine grit—help eliminate minor imperfections and ensure a comfortable cutting experience.

The goal is to achieve a smooth yet natural texture that allows knives to glide without obstruction. Acacia wood responds exceptionally well to sanding due to its dense fibers, revealing patterns and tones that highlight its aesthetic value.

A polished acacia cutting board showcases a blend of light and dark streaks, which is a signature characteristic valued by premium kitchenware buyers.

Applying Food-Safe Oil or Finish

Finishing enhances both appearance and durability. A food-safe oil, typically mineral oil or natural plant-based oil, is applied to the board’s surface. Acacia wood absorbs these oils well, developing richer color depth and improved moisture resistance.

The oiling process not only protects the fibers but also highlights the natural grain structure. It helps the board resist drying and cracking, making maintenance easier for end users. Why Acacia Wood Is Ideal for Cutting Boards

Acacia stands out among hardwoods for its durability, moisture resistance, and rich coloration. Its natural hardness ensures that cutting boards withstand years of use without deep scarring. Meanwhile, its tight grain reduces the absorption of liquids, supporting hygiene and easier cleaning.

Acacia is also known for its sustainable growth patterns, making it an environmentally responsible choice for large-scale production. Restaurants, retailers, and households value acacia boards for their blend of strength and beauty.
